This 2013 Ranger Tugs R-31 CB is a fiberglass trawler powered by a single 300-hp Volvo diesel engine with 830 hours. The hull is finished in navy blue and has been operated exclusively in freshwater. The boat measures 31 feet in length with a 10-foot beam, providing a stable platform for extended cruising.
The layout includes two cabins and two heads, accommodating couples or small families for overnight passages. The pilothouse features dual helm stations and a sliding door with screen, along with a docking station in the cockpit. The boat is equipped with bow and stern thrusters for maneuvering in tight spaces, a generator with low hours, shorepower capability with cords, and a solar panel mounted on a flip-up frame.
Maintenance and preparation have been completed ahead of the 2026 season, including a fresh bottom paint, wash, and wax, with full engine service performed. A 2020 Zodiac Cadet 270 Ultra Light inflatable tender with a Mercury 6-hp outboard is included, mounted with weaver snap davits and a stern rail motor bracket.
